Zuken launches new PCB design suite for concept-to-manufacturing, multi-board system design

October 25, 2011 ? Munich, Germany and Westford, MA, USA ? Zuken today announces CR-8000, a new PCB design product family that is specifically designed for system-level multi-board design. The CR-8000 suite is the only concept-to-manufacturing, multi-board design solution that has been developed from the start to address the unique requirements of today’s ever-increasing challenges in system-level design optimization.

The suite’s fully integrated design flow ranges from initial system planning, where critical design decisions are made about design partitioning, component selection, and form, fit, and function of the product or system; through detailed schematic and PCB design; and optimized manufacturing output.

All of the products in this flow inherently support and facilitate multi-board design for system level design optimization:

  • System Planner – a system-level design environment for up-front planning and partitioning of electronics systems.
  • Design Gateway – an engineering platform for logical circuit design and verification of single and multi-board system-level electronic designs.
  • Design Force – a system-level IC package and PCB design and analysis solution combining conventional 2D design with 3D design in real-time using the latest human interface techniques.
  • DFM Center – a comprehensive manufacturing preparation and output solution supporting panelization and common output formats.

“In the process of researching CR-8000, we found that system design cannot only be single board design, as in the past,” says Gerhard Lipski, general manager Zuken Europe and Americas, and member of Zuken’s board of directors. “It had to handle multi-board design throughout the flow. But we realized that to do it right we had to start again. This not only optimizes our solution for today, but gives us the ability to keep up with future advances much more easily.”

Future-proof design technology

Over the last decade, there have been numerous technology advances that enable a major step forward in PCB system design. CR-8000 has been designed from the start to take advantage of the latest advances in hardware and software technologies to offer unmatched user productivity and system performance. CR-8000 includes the latest in:

  • human interface techniques – a mouse and a touch pad combine for fewer mouse clicks and movements, minimal dialogs and panels
  • hardware – using 64-bit, multi-thread and multi-CPU
  • graphics – through OpenGL and DirectX
  • network environments – with standalone client, data server, application server and cloud computing support.
